The garage occupancy feed for the Brindlewood campus arrives over a message queue every thirty seconds, one record per level, published by the Stallgrid edge boxes. Counts can briefly go negative when a sensor double-fires on exit; the ingest job clamps these to zero and flags the interval. If the feed stalls for more than five minutes, the dashboard falls back to the last known snapshot. Sensor mappings, queue names, and the replay procedure are documented on the internal page below.

runbook for tahog-kadug: https://gitlab.qirvanworks.corp/projects/pages/view/b139298aed28

Welcome to on-call for the Glimmerpane design system! Our snapshot tests live in the `snapcheck` suite and run on every merge to main. If a UI component changes visually, the diff bot flags it — usually it's an intentional tweak, so just approve the new baseline. If it's 2am and snapshots are failing across the board, it's almost always a font-loading race, not your problem. To unlock the baseline store and re-approve snapshots in bulk, use the recovery passphrase below.

recovery phrase for tahag-taguf: wenix-caswyn

Onboarding note for the Ledgerpane admin table: bulk edits are applied through the batcher service, not directly against the database. Select rows, choose an action, and the batcher stages changes in a pending set you can review before commit. Edits over 500 rows require a second approver — this is enforced server-side, so don't try to chunk around it. To run the batcher locally you need the staging write credential, which goes in your .env as the next line.

secret setting of bahip-kagag: RELAY_SECRET3=c83

# Break-Glass: Catalog Cache Invalidation

Scope: the Pinrow product catalog at Veldstone Retail. If stale prices persist after a purge and the Hollowmere invalidation queue is wedged, use break-glass to flush the edge tier directly. Contractors: get verbal sign-off from the catalog lead first. Steps: open the Hollowmere admin shell, select emergency-flush, confirm the tenant, and run it once — repeated flushes thrash the origin. Access is logged and expires after 20 minutes. Unseal the admin shell with the passphrase below.

recovery phrase for kahop-tajog: istix-casvan